We went down for the Life is Beautiful Festival that took place in Downtown Las Vegas. It’s a new 2-day festival–showcasing music, food, and art–with the purpose of celebrating life through artistic passion. With musical headliners, such as Beck, The Killers, Kings of Leon, and Imagine Dragons, and artistic genius (epitomized through street art, acclaimed chefs, and theatrics), life couldn’t have been any more beautiful.
